Talking Point - Mike Sainsbury calls for more clarity from guidance on methods used to detect unexploded ordnance.
Developers, contractors and other stakeholders in the construction industry are receiving conflicting advice on methodologies used to ensure the safety of ground works from the risk of unexploded ordnance (UXO).
